This article looks at the parental side of the coin when teachers
assign projects, English and otherwise.

"Stop the forced labor for parents immediately! Enough!" Yael, a
mother of three from the Sharon region, wrote. "When my eldest
daughter was in fifth grade she had to keep a reading journal, in
English, for a high-school-level book. The parents had to work with
the children or hire a private tutor," Yael relates. The situation
reached a level of absurdity when some fifth-graders in her
neighborhood asked their parents for money and hired a graphic artist
to prepare a slide presentation they were assigned to create but
didn't know how.
